What is the opportunity?

As an RBC Investment and Retirement Planner, you create custom investment solutions for prospective and existing RBC clients. Alongside your own prospecting and networking activity, you are fully supported by internal partners who send client referrals your way. Your creativity, motivation, and drive for new investment sales will enable you to provide world-class advice and solutions that help clients achieve their long-term financial goals.

What will you do?

  • Provide tailor-made financial planning advice and solutions using our unparalleled array of investment and portfolio solutions, including best-in-class proprietary and select third-party mutual fund solutions
  • Acquire and consolidate existing and new-to-RBC clients and assets
  • Connect clients with the right RBC team members to help continuously meet their needs
  • Develop external business referral sources through networking, marketing, and your centres of influence

What do you need to succeed?

Must-have

  • Financial Planning Designation (PFP, QAFP or CFP)
  • Mutual Funds License (IFIC or CSC)
  • Minimum 2 years’ experience in financial planning
  • Proven networking and client acquisition skills
  • Ability to cultivate strong partner relationships
  • Digital Savviness, ability to effectively utilize mobile applications
